EO08 YOY is a 2008 Peugeot 4007 in Blue with a 2,179c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.7%.
Across all 2008 Peugeot 4007 models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.7% with a typical mileage of 88,854 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Peugeot 4007 f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 681 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EO08 YOY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Peugeot 4007 typ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 18 years old, this Peugeot 4007 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
